Flora Annie Steel’s novel ‘In the Permanent Way’ is a remarkable piece of literature that delves into the complexities of human relationships and social norms in the colonial British India. Written in a realistic and descriptive style, the book transports the reader to a time where cultural clashes and personal dilemmas were prevalent. Through vivid imagery and character-driven narratives, Steel paints a poignant picture of the struggles faced by individuals from diverse backgrounds, highlighting themes of love, loss, and redemption. The detailed depiction of Indian landscapes and traditions adds depth to the story, making it a compelling read for those interested in historical fiction with a focus on societal issues. Flora Annie Steel, a British author who spent a significant part of her life in India, drew inspiration from her first-hand experiences to create ‘In the Permanent Way’. Her keen observations of the Indian society and her empathy towards its people shine through in the novel, showcasing her deep understanding of the cultural nuances and challenges faced by the Indian populace during the colonial era. I highly recommend ‘In the Permanent Way’ to readers who enjoy thought-provoking historical fiction that explores themes of identity, class distinctions, and the resilience of the human spirit. Steel’s insightful portrayal of characters and her skillful storytelling make this novel a valuable addition to the genre.
